    If you're refering to encoding with tmpg, and lets say that
    you are caping tv, then your source (no matter what) (and
    no matter what anyone else says) is interlaced!! I, personally
    don't like using tmpgenc to do my de-interlacing. I frame
    serve via virtual dub and use the filters (deinterlace) and
    send to tmpg. When I do this, natually I (you) MUST turn
    off (uncheck) the boxes that say [] Interlace or in the advanced
    box, make sure it selected as Progressive or non-interlace.
    Cause that what it is when tmpg is being served from virtualdub.
    However, if you're not frameserving from virtual to tmpb, but you
    are encoding straight from your avi file to tmpg, then you have to
    turn on interlace under source because that is what your source (avi)
    is! Next you have to (under Advanced tab) [x] check for De-Interlace
    and choose Blend (is the best - no matter what anyone else says here)

    You would think so, but actually, there isn't. If the source is interlaced and truly 50/60Hz field based then that source *does not contain the information* needed to faithfully reconstruct a full resolution progressive scan equivalent of one field.

    No deinterlacing filter can do more than *hope* to be a good approximation of the original scene - the algorithm it uses will tends to work well on many sources, but very badly with some. If you are not satisfied with the results from all the filters you have tried then I'm afraid there is little you can do...

    ps. If you are lucky the source was originally recorded on film from which an *interlacing* filter has generated the video for television. In that case it *is* possibly to reconstruct the original frames, provided they have'nt been too savaged by all the analog video copying in between.
